Looks like you got the embedding part pretty good, no missing chunks of wax on the picture like I had my first try :grin2:

Maybe try to do some photo editing on the picture. Either fade out the background around her or maybe fill it in with a solid complementing color. Then pick a shape like oval or rectangle and make the color fade out. Personally I put all my pictures on a rectangular paper to embed, changing only the shape of the photo itself inside. It makes it much easier to get it straight and the white border hardly shows in the wax.

Looks like you did a good job of embedding the picture. It just takes practice editing and framing pictures. I like to leave a white margin below the picture. Makes it a lot easier to position the picture in the mold. I'm sure she will be thrilled with it.
